Basicly- Scince penny Arcade mentioned it- im seeing a whole lot of folks tryng this out (Marathon pro, Lightweight pro, Commando pro and Tac knife) And just wanted your thoughts on it- i find it works very well but leaves you a little vulnerable. But as far as being fun to play- its got to be the most fun weapon set ive used.
